Output 901018600938f72acf5c71701a3757778ef3c8bfad43f4c73cf211a9520535e0:0

value
141520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14efe3d0e87cd145c95371a9aacd27263571bdf OP_EQUAL
address
3HrYA32wkctHVqg6maCHh6x58rBPsEX344
transaction
901018600938f72acf5c71701a3757778ef3c8bfad43f4c73cf211a9520535e0
spent
true